What two classes of motion did Aristotle advocate?

Aristotle advocated two classes of motion: natural motion, which is inherent to objects and includes vertical motion (up or down), and violent motion, which is caused by an external force and includes horizontal motion (push or pull).

How was Aristotle's dynamic motion theory proven wrong?

Aristotle's dynamic motion theory was proven wrong by a man named Galileo. He tested Aristotle's theory by dropping a heavy object and a lighter object at the same time. The experiment proved Aristotle wrong because the result was that the two objects were falling at the same rate (speed).


What was Aristotle's theory of motion?

Aristotle beleived that motion involved a change from potentiality to actuality. He proposed that the speed at which two identically shaped objects sink or fall is directly proportional to their weights and inversely proportional to the density of the medium through which they move.


Were Aristotle's predictions of heavenly motion quantitative or qualiative?

I. Aristotle's Theory of Motion • Two basic principles: I. No motion without a mover in contact with moving body. II. Distinction between: (a) Natural motion: mover is internal to moving body (b) Forced motion: mover is external to moving body
